Gardman R361 Kensington Arch. Create a beautiful, inviting entry into your garden with this elegant, classically styled arch. Provides an attractive archway for climbing plants and adds a stunning feature to any garden. The two side panels feature straight vertical bars with a graceful scrollwork heart design; one elegant heart rests atop another inverted heart. Gently curved top mimics the horizontal bar detail of the side sections. Horizontal bars provide structural support and serve as an ideal place to hang lightweight, potted plants. This arch is perfect for supporting climbing plants and vines or for displaying small hanging accents. Train your plants to grow through the arbor by weaving them in and out of the structure as they grow. Constructed of sturdy square-section metal; powder coated in a durable “verdigris” finish. Verdigris coloration will blend with any surrounding. Ground stakes included for added stability. Easy to assemble with complete instructions included. Dimensions: 20.5” Long x 45” Wide x 82” High.
